Job Description
As a Chemical Process Engineer III you will provide technical expertise to ensure the operation produces products that meet all quality, cost, and efficiency requirements at a 24/7 manufacturing facility. This role will identify ways to improve safety, quality, yields, and the capability of existing processes while also assisting in the scale up and implementation of developmental products/processes. It will be focused on strategic projects and improvements as well as the development of Solstice’s next generation of Spectra products by designing, testing and/or validating products from prototype to market.
Core challenges include leading continuous process improvement to drive Key Performance Indicators for the operation to meet goals established by the business while providing technical guidance to the operations team and assisting with process troubleshooting.
